Citi analsyt David Driscoll said while the consensus is that Kraft Heinz Company (NYSE: KHC) targets Mondelez Int'l (NASDAQ: MDLZ) in a takeover, they believe probabilities have now shifted more towards a takeover of General Mills (NYSE: GIS) and Kellogg (NYSE: K). Driscoll cited the election of Trump and the expected economic and fiscal policies.

"While our sense is that Mondelez is the consensus expectation, we think the probabilities have now shifted more towards General Mills and Kellogg given of the outcome of the U.S. Presidential election and the expected economic & fiscal policies on the horizon," he commented.

While Driscoll is not ruling out Mondelez, he sees all three yielding substantial benefits.
